An irrevocable trust – or in this case, a Medicaid trust – should give anyone pause before creating one. Ceding control of a significant portion of your assets should only occur for a few reasons: keeping assets from creditors, reducing taxes or becoming eligible for government assistance. WebSo if a trust beneficiary applies for Medicaid at any time before 2 January of Year 6, the trust beneficiary will be confronted with a 40 month penalty period, or self payment period, that begins on the date an application for Medicaid assistance is made, but is pro-rated. WebNov 23, 2024 · As long as contributions are made to the trust more than five years before the donor applies for Medicaid long-term care benefits, the state Medicaid office will not penalize the donor for transferring assets to the trust, and the existence of the assets will not affect Medicaid eligibility. WebAug 20, 2024 · Yes, putting your home in a trust can protect it from Medicaid, but it is extremely important to mention that not all trusts will serve this purpose. In other words, not all trusts are Medicaid compliant, and putting a home into a non-Medicaid compliant trust will not protect it from Medicaid’s estate recovery program (MERP).
